These assessments will determine if your student is ready for an algebra course. A passing grade indicates readiness for that level of algebra. If students make 100%, have them take the next level to determine if they can move up.

If they did not make a passing score, review student answers to see if the errors were typographical or if they understand their mistakes.

Ultimately it is your decision for the student to enroll in a course, but the most success will be found when they have a good understanding of the previous level.
